| Date / Time | Away / Home Team | Away / Home Player |
| Nov 04, 2006 | Los Angeles Kings | Raitis Ivanans |
| 1pd 02:53 | Phoenix Coyotes | Georges Laraque |
| Comments: They drop the gloves and square off at center ice. The two grab onto each other and Laraque throws three lefts and Ivanans one of his own just before they fall to the ice. They quickly return to their feet and Laraque connects with two lefts that knock Ivanans' helmet off. Ivanans then gets Laraque in a headlock and throws a left. Laraque gets free, throwing two more lefts and is then able to push Ivanans to the ice. The linesmen come in shortly after. | ||
